Hormonal Anchors of Motivation
Hormones act as critical chemical regulators, influencing everything from mood and cognition to physical capacity. Among these, testosterone stands out as a primary architect of drive and motivation. Its presence is intrinsically linked to alertness, cognitive sharpness, and the very perception of energy. When testosterone levels are optimized, they support dopamine pathways, the brain’s reward and motivation circuitry, making challenging tasks feel more manageable and engaging.
Testosterone’s influence extends to mood regulation, impacting serotonin levels, which are crucial for emotional stability and a positive outlook. As testosterone levels naturally decline with age ∞ a process that can begin as early as the 30s ∞ individuals may experience a corresponding decrease in motivation, increased fatigue, and a dulling of cognitive acuity. This hormonal shift is not an inevitable consequence of aging but a biological signal that requires attention.
Testosterone levels influence dopamine signaling, directly impacting motivation and alertness, and serotonin production, which is key for mood stability.
Beyond testosterone, other hormonal systems, such as those involving estrogen and stress hormones like cortisol, also play significant roles. Estradiol, for instance, offers neuroprotective benefits and supports cognitive function, particularly in areas like the hippocampus. Conversely, chronically elevated cortisol, the body’s primary stress hormone, can disrupt cognitive processes and deplete the very drive it is meant to signal in response to perceived threats.

Peptides ∞ The Body’s Precision Messengers
Peptides, short chains of amino acids, are the body’s sophisticated signaling molecules, each designed for a specific biological task. When natural production wanes or systems become imbalanced, exogenous peptides can act as precise messengers, helping to restore optimal function. They are not crude interventions but refined tools that can influence cellular processes, support repair mechanisms, and enhance neurotransmitter activity.
For cognitive function and stress resilience, peptides like Semax and Selank are noteworthy. Semax, a derivative of ACTH, modulates dopamine and upregulates Brain-Derived Neurotrophic Factor (BDNF), a protein vital for neuron survival, growth, and synaptic plasticity. This positions Semax as a powerful ally for enhancing focus, memory consolidation, and cognitive endurance. Selank, on the other hand, influences GABA and serotonin pathways, offering anxiolytic effects and promoting emotional balance, which is critical for sustained mental performance under pressure.
For physical drive and recovery, peptides like BPC-157 are recognized for their potent tissue-healing properties. BPC-157 promotes angiogenesis (new blood vessel formation), enhances fibroblast activity for tissue repair, and exerts anti-inflammatory effects, accelerating recovery from injuries and improving overall physical resilience.
Growth hormone secretagogues, such as CJC-1295 and Ipamorelin, also play a significant role in vitality. These peptides stimulate the pituitary gland to release growth hormone (GH) and Insulin-like Growth Factor 1 (IGF-1). Optimized GH and IGF-1 levels are fundamental for muscle growth, fat metabolism, cellular repair, and improved sleep quality, all of which contribute to sustained energy and drive.

Mitochondrial Health ∞ The Cellular Powerhouse
At the cellular level, the efficiency of mitochondria ∞ the powerhouses of our cells ∞ is paramount. These organelles are responsible for converting nutrients into ATP, the body’s primary energy currency. As we age, or due to chronic stress and lifestyle factors, mitochondrial function can decline, leading to fatigue, brain fog, and a general reduction in vitality.
Nicotinamide Adenine Dinucleotide (NAD+) is a critical coenzyme essential for cellular energy production and DNA repair. Its levels naturally decrease with age, impairing mitochondrial function. Therapies that replenish NAD+ can help restore cellular energy, support cognitive function, and activate longevity pathways.
Methylene Blue, a compound with a long medical history, acts as an electron shuttle within the mitochondria, enhancing ATP production and reducing oxidative stress. When combined, NAD+ and Methylene Blue offer a synergistic approach to boosting cellular energy and resilience.
Mitochondrial dysfunction is linked to fatigue, brain fog, and neurodegenerative diseases, underscoring the importance of NAD+ and Methylene Blue for cellular energy.

Strategic Hormone Calibration
The concept of “hormone optimization” moves beyond simple replacement, focusing instead on achieving ideal levels tailored to individual physiology and goals. While clinical guidelines suggest caution regarding testosterone therapy for general vitality in otherwise healthy men, they acknowledge its potential benefits for specific symptoms like sexual dysfunction. For individuals seeking peak performance, a comprehensive assessment is paramount.
This involves evaluating not just total testosterone but also free and bioavailable testosterone, SHBG, estrogen, DHEA, thyroid hormones, and other critical markers. These hormones operate in a complex, interconnected cascade. Optimizing one without considering the others can lead to imbalances.
Therefore, a data-driven approach, often guided by a knowledgeable clinician, is essential to identify root causes of hormonal imbalance ∞ whether they stem from lifestyle factors like poor sleep, excessive stress, inadequate nutrition, or underlying medical conditions ∞ before implementing targeted interventions.
The choice of delivery method for hormone therapy also matters, with intramuscular formulations often favored for their cost-effectiveness and comparable efficacy to transdermal options, though individual preferences and responses can vary.

The Importance of a Phased Approach
When considering interventions like testosterone therapy, clinical guidelines suggest a phased approach. Initial assessment, followed by a trial period, and then re-evaluation of symptoms and benefits within a defined timeframe (e.g. 12 months) is recommended. Treatment should be discontinued if desired improvements in specific areas, like sexual function, are not achieved. Critically, initiating testosterone therapy solely for generalized improvements in energy, vitality, or cognition is not supported by current evidence.
Peptide therapies, while often demonstrating rapid effects in certain areas, also benefit from a strategic application. For example, growth hormone secretagogues like CJC-1295 and Ipamorelin are often stacked, with Ipamorelin providing an initial pulse and CJC-1295 offering sustained release. This mimics natural hormonal rhythms more effectively than single-peptide use.

Lifestyle as the Foundational Pillar
It is crucial to recognize that no hormonal or peptide intervention can fully compensate for fundamental lifestyle deficiencies. Optimizing sleep quality, managing stress effectively, adhering to a nutrient-dense diet, and engaging in consistent, appropriate exercise form the bedrock upon which all other optimizations are built. These lifestyle factors directly influence hormone production and receptor sensitivity.
For instance, excess body fat, particularly visceral fat, can increase estrogen conversion from testosterone, negatively impacting hormonal balance. Addressing these foundational elements is not merely complementary; it is prerequisite for achieving sustainable and robust personal drive.
